Conveying mechanism
Technical Field
The invention relates to the technical field of transmission equipment, in particular to a conveying mechanism.
Background
In the current machining process or production process, in order to improve the production efficiency and the production quality, the products to be machined are often conveyed in a timed and quantitative manner, such as: the cutting of metal pipeline, panel location punch etc. when the specification and the shape of needs product are unanimous, just need adopt the transport of timing ration, solve the manual not convenient for inaccuracy that brings. The prior art is to the mode of this type of transportation, adopts power devices such as motor or hydraulic pump mostly, and the rotation that drives the gear realizes, but this type of technique is because long-term work at motor or hydraulic pump can make production error increase gradually, is unfavorable for long-time production, has also reduced production efficiency.

Detailed Description
The invention is further illustrated with reference to the following figures and examples.
Referring to fig. 1 to 3, a conveying mechanism includes a limiting mechanism, a motor 1 and a driving fluted disc 10 connected to the motor 1, the driving fluted disc 10 is connected to a driven fluted disc 11 through an annular chain 2, the limiting mechanism is arranged at the upper end of the annular chain 2, a groove body 5 for the limiting mechanism to slide is arranged in the middle of the annular chain 2, the groove body 5 is located at the central line position of the limiting mechanism, the upper end of the limiting mechanism is connected to a pawl 6, the conveying mechanism further includes a conveying belt 8, a rack 9 matched with the pawl 6 is arranged at the lower end of the conveying belt 8, a critical point exists when the pawl 6 rotates clockwise, the critical point is that the pawl 6 cannot rotate anticlockwise when being matched with the rack 9, a stop block is arranged in the mechanism, and the explanation is not provided in the drawings, which is convenient for.
In fig. 4, the limiting mechanism includes a carrier 3, limiting plates 17 are disposed at both ends of the carrier 3, a first limiting post 12 and a limiting block 4 are disposed on the limiting plate 17, a rotary table 18 is further disposed on the limiting plate 17, a stop 16 is connected to one end of the first limiting post 12 close to the rotary table 18, the stop 16 and the limiting block 4 are both connected to the rotary table 18, a protruding block 13 adapted to the two limiting blocks 4 is disposed on the endless chain 2, a second limiting post 14 adapted to the two first limiting posts 12 is disposed at both ends of the endless chain 2, the stop 16 is further connected to a return spring 15, the rotary table 18 is rotatably connected to the limiting plate 17, a cylinder is further disposed on the rotary table 18, the stop 16 is connected to the cylinder, specifically, the limiting block 4 is connected to the first limiting post 12 by the reciprocating rotation of the rotary table 18, the movement of the protruding block 13 is controlled, so that the whole structure, and errors are effectively solved.
Further, a limit plate 17 extends from one end of the first limit post 12 away from the stopper 16. The first limiting column 12 is conveniently aligned with the second limiting column 14, the limiting block 4 protrudes to form a clamping block 41, the end portion of the clamping block 41 is in a convex arc shape, the convex block 13 is conveniently controlled to move, and the end, away from the clamping block 16, of the first limiting column 12 is in a concave arc shape, and is conveniently matched with the second limiting column 14. A return spring 16 is connected to the pawl 6.
The working principle of the invention is as follows: the product to be processed is placed on the conveyer belt 8, the motor 1 is started, under the drive of the motor 1, the driving fluted disc 10 runs at a certain speed, and simultaneously drives the driven fluted disc 11 and the annular chain 2 to run anticlockwise, so that the lug 13 arranged on the annular chain 2 also runs together with the annular chain 2, due to the existence of the limit block 4, the lug 13 pushes the carrier 3 and the pawl 6 arranged above the carrier 3 to move leftwards, the pawl 6 drives the conveyer belt 8 to move, when the first limit column 12 contacts with the second limit column 14 after a period of movement, the second limit column 14 pushes the limit block 16 to move rightwards, so as to drive the clockwise rotation of the turntable 18, the limit block 4 moves upwards due to the clockwise rotation of the turntable 18, at the moment, the lug 13 loses the limit of the limit block 4, continues to move leftwards along with the annular chain 2, and the limit block 16 is under the action of the, the carrier is quickly returned to the initial state, time difference exists in the movement of the convex block 13 on the annular chain 2, and therefore products conveyed are convenient to process, when the convex block 13 moves to be in contact with the limiting block 4 at the lower end of the carrier 3, the carrier 3 is driven to move leftwards, at the moment, due to the matching characteristic of the pawl 6 and the rack, the position of the conveying belt cannot be changed, when the carrier 3 moves to be in contact with another second limiting column 14, the same working principle is adopted, the convex block 13 continues to move along with the annular chain 2, next product conveying is started, and according to the actual situation, the length of the processing time can be achieved by changing the length of the annular chain 13 or adjusting the rotating speed of the motor 1.
The invention has the beneficial effects that: utilize mechanical principle, reach the transport to the timing ration of product, solved among the prior art because long-time processing, lead to the problem that there is the error in product production, improved work efficiency and product quality.
